About the match

Match summary

The Serie A round 3 fixture Inter - SSC Napoli is scheduled for 4 September 2026 at San Siro/Giuseppe Meazza, Milano.

Inter are the market favourite with an implied probability of about 58 percent to win; the draw is priced around 28 percent, and SSC Napoli about 21 percent.

Inter are second after two matches; SSC Napoli are tenth.

Form analysis and trajectory

  • Inter have opened with two consecutive league victories, scoring five and conceding one across those games. The early pattern points to controlled defending and efficient chance conversion; their average player rating so far is 8.19.
  • SSC Napoli split their first two league matches, winning once before a defeat, with three goals scored and two conceded. The results suggest competitive performances but slightly reduced attacking output compared with Inter; their average player rating stands at 7.39.

Key match insights

  • Head-to-head balance in the provided sample: Inter 3 wins, SSC Napoli 2 wins, with 5 draws; the most recent meeting finished 2-2.
  • Manager head-to-head: no previous meetings between Cristian Chivu and Massimiliano Allegri are recorded in the supplied data.
  • Team performance indicator: Inter’s average player rating is 8.19 versus SSC Napoli’s 7.39 across the opening league fixtures.
  • Venue: San Siro/Giuseppe Meazza, Milano, capacity 75,817.

Sentiment and predictions

Market sentiment favours Inter at home, aligning with their stronger early-season metrics and league position. Draw frequency in the head-to-head sample is notable, which keeps the stalemate as the secondary outcome by pricing, while SSC Napoli are rated the outsider.
